This updated port should build the latest truecrypt 5.1a on freebsd. It
depends on wxgtk28 with unicode. The NOGUI version dpes also require wx
base libraries. So wxgtk28-unicode is marked as dependency.
I have done some load test on today's 7-STABLE amd64, however it needs
more testing

Hi,
TrueCrypt 5.0 is without kernel dependencies. Furthermore there is
support for FreeBSD, if you have a look at the Makefile.
Cheers, Oliver
